The Cradle of Cricket. Founded in 1750, Hambledon Cricket Club was once the most powerful club in the country and earned its reputation as the cradle of cricket . The club now plays at the idyllic Ridge Meadow its home since the 1780s and fields three adult teams, the 1st XI playing in Division 2 of the Southern Premier League.
